Position Summary
We are looking for a skilled Diesel Technician to inspect, diagnose, repair, and maintain diesel engines and related systems in trucks, buses, heavy equipment, or other diesel-powered vehicles. The ideal candidate will have strong mechanical aptitude, attention to detail, and the 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ced environment.
Primary Duties And Responsibilities
Inspect, diagnose, and repair diesel engines, transmissions, and other mechanical systems
Perform preventative maintenance (PM) services on diesel vehicles and equipment
Troubleshoot electrical, hydraulic, and fuel system issues
Test drive vehicles to ensure proper repair and functionality
Maintain accurate service records and repair documentation
Use diagnostic tools and software to identify faults and issues
Order parts and assist in inventory management as needed
Follow all safety procedures and guidelines to ensure a safe work environment
Communicate with service advisors or customers regarding repairs and timelines
Keep work area clean and organized
Job Qualifications
High school diploma or equivalent; technical school or diesel mechanic certification preferred
2+ years of experience as a diesel technician or similar role
Strong understanding of diesel engines, fuel systems, electrical systems, and diagnostic tools
Ability to read technical manuals and schematics
Proficient with hand tools and power tools
Strong problem-solving and time management skills
Valid driver’s license; CDL may be required or preferred
